Thunder Bay Press, 1991. Red cloth (hardcover) in mylar protected dust-jacket, (11 1/4 x 8 3/4 inches). 426 pages, plus Vessel Index; illustrated. The sequel to "Great Lakes Ships We Remember." 180 vessels are chronicled with photographs and text. An important contribution to North American Maritime history. A clean, tight bright copy.. Cloth. Fine/Near Fine. Quarto.
